飛行員睡眠品質與認知功能之探討

The Sleep Quality and Cognitive Function of Aircrew in ROCAF

摘要


睡眠品質不佳可能會引起疲勞的現象,導致飛行員出現草率、怠慢、注意力不集中、以及影響認知功能,進而危害飛安。然而,造成睡眠品質不佳的因素有很多,例如工作壓力、輪班工作、以及工作時數過長等。 本研究之目的在探討飛行員之睡眠品質與認知功能,以三個空軍基地的120名飛行員為研究對象(34.4±7.0歲),採用匹堡堡睡眠品質指標(PSQI)設計評估問卷,以威斯康辛卡片分類測驗(WCST)評估認知的功能。 本研究的結果顯示:睡眠品質之平均總分為4.93±2.3分;若以5分為切點區分之,則有35%為睡眠品質不佳;睡眠品質良好與睡眠不佳兩組之間有50%的WCST次項分數呈顯著差異;且PSQI的總分與50%的WCST次項分數呈顯著的相關。因此,睡眠品質對飛行員的認知功能確有影響,必須予以適當的調節,以免影響到飛安。

並列摘要


Introduction: Insufficient sleep could induce fatigue and cause aircrew sloppy, inattentive, inefficient, and impaired cognitive function that would threat safety. The high work pressure, shift work, and long duty cycles could be the reasons of poor sleep quality. This study is to investigate the relationship between the sleep quality and cognitive function of aircrew. Methods: One hundred and twenty health pilots (34.4±7.0 ages) voluntarily participated this project. The quality of sleep was evaluated using Pittsburgh Sleep Quality Index (PSQI). Cognitive function was assessed using Wisconsin Card Sorting Test-computer version 3 (WCST-CV3). Results: The average PSQI global score was 4.93±2.3. There were 35% of subjective classified as poor sleeper whose scores were over the cutoff point of 5. Comparing the scores of WCST between good sleeper group and poor sleeper group, we found significant difference from 50% of sub-items. Besides, significant correlation existed between PSQI and 50% of sub-items of WCST. Totally, 70% of sub-items of BSRS were also affected by the sleep quality. Conclusion: Sleep quality could affect the cognitive task of aircrew to some extent. Appropriate countermeasures will be required to improve their sleep quality for flying safety.
